Buying Guide: How To Choose A Long Distance Wireless Microphone System

When evaluating long-range wireless mics, consider these practical factors to match your space and use case.

  • Range Needs: For large venues, prioritize systems offering 250–500+ feet line-of-sight range. Consider potential obstacles like walls and crowds that can reduce real-world distance.
  • Frequency Type: UHF and 2.4GHz systems have different behavior. UHF offers more stability in RF-dense environments, while 2.4GHz systems provide broad compatibility and simpler pairing.
  • Latency: Lower latency is important for live performance and speaking to ensure vocals stay synchronized with on-stage action. Look for sub-5 ms latency if possible.
  • Battery Life: Longer playtime reduces downtime between sets. Check official battery figures and charging method (USB-C is common and convenient).
  • Channel Management: Auto-scan, AI matching, or manual channel selection affects how easily you maintain clean audio in crowded venues.
  • Connectivity: Ensure the receiver has compatible outputs (6.35mm, 3.5mm, or balanced XLR) to fit your sound system or mixer.
  • Durability And Setup: Metal housings and straightforward pairing simplify transport and on-site setup for frequent use.

Best practice is to map your venue’s size and typical audience to a range requirement, then choose a system with reliable auto-frequency features and robust audio fidelity. For multi-speaker events, a dual-mic or quad-mic arrangement can prevent audience noise from overpowering the main signal.

FAQ

  1. Q: Do these systems require professional installation?
    A: Most are plug-and-play with automatic frequency management, though larger venues may benefit from a technician’s RF planning.
  2. Q: Will multiple mics cause interference?
    A: Modern systems include auto-scan, PLL, and adaptive frequency hopping to minimize interference, but plan channel assignments to avoid cross-talk.
  3. Q: Can I connect these mics to a mixer or PA system?
    A: Yes. Most receivers offer 6.35mm or 3.5mm outputs, with some models providing additional ports or direct mixer integration.
  4. Q: How long do the batteries last?
    A: Battery life varies by model, but many units offer 8–40+ hours per charge depending on usage and battery type.
  5. Q: What if the RF crowding is high?
    A: Use the system’s auto-scan or AI matching features, manually select cleaner frequencies, and consider using external RF boosters or re-allocating channels.
  6. Q: Are AI Auto Match systems better than traditional ones?
    A: AI Auto Match can speed setup and improve stability in typical environments, but in extreme RF congestion, additional channel planning is still beneficial.
